1 |
|
2 | import type { GenerateConfig } from 'rc-picker/lib/generate/index';
|
3 | import type { AnyObject } from '../../_util/type';
|
4 | export type { PickerLocale, PickerProps } from './interface';
|
5 | declare function generatePicker<DateType extends AnyObject>(generateConfig: GenerateConfig<DateType>): (<ValueType = DateType>(props: import("./interface").PickerPropsWithMultiple<DateType, import("./interface").PickerProps<DateType>, ValueType>) => import("react").ReactElement<any, string | import("react").JSXElementConstructor<any>>) & {
|
6 | displayName?: string | undefined;
|
7 | } & {
|
8 | displayName?: string | undefined;
|
9 | WeekPicker: (<ValueType_1 = DateType>(props: import("./interface").PickerPropsWithMultiple<DateType, Omit<import("./interface").PickerProps<DateType>, "picker">, ValueType_1>) => import("react").ReactElement<any, string | import("react").JSXElementConstructor<any>>) & {
|
10 | displayName?: string | undefined;
|
11 | };
|
12 | MonthPicker: (<ValueType_1 = DateType>(props: import("./interface").PickerPropsWithMultiple<DateType, Omit<import("./interface").PickerProps<DateType>, "picker">, ValueType_1>) => import("react").ReactElement<any, string | import("react").JSXElementConstructor<any>>) & {
|
13 | displayName?: string | undefined;
|
14 | };
|
15 | YearPicker: (<ValueType_1 = DateType>(props: import("./interface").PickerPropsWithMultiple<DateType, Omit<import("./interface").PickerProps<DateType>, "picker">, ValueType_1>) => import("react").ReactElement<any, string | import("react").JSXElementConstructor<any>>) & {
|
16 | displayName?: string | undefined;
|
17 | };
|
18 | RangePicker: import("react").ForwardRefExoticComponent<Omit<import("rc-picker").RangePickerProps<DateType>, "locale" | "generateConfig" | "hideHeader"> & {
|
19 | locale?: import("./interface").PickerLocale | undefined;
|
20 | size?: import("antd/es/button").ButtonSize;
|
21 | placement?: "bottomLeft" | "bottomRight" | "topLeft" | "topRight" | undefined;
|
22 | bordered?: boolean | undefined;
|
23 | status?: "" | "warning" | "error" | undefined;
|
24 | variant?: "filled" | "outlined" | "borderless" | undefined;
|
25 | dropdownClassName?: string | undefined;
|
26 | popupClassName?: string | undefined;
|
27 | rootClassName?: string | undefined;
|
28 | popupStyle?: import("react").CSSProperties | undefined;
|
29 | } & import("react").RefAttributes<import("rc-picker").PickerRef>>;
|
30 | TimePicker: (<ValueType_2 = DateType>(props: import("./interface").PickerPropsWithMultiple<DateType, Omit<import("./interface").GenericTimePickerProps<DateType>, "picker">, ValueType_2>) => import("react").ReactElement<any, string | import("react").JSXElementConstructor<any>>) & {
|
31 | displayName?: string | undefined;
|
32 | };
|
33 | QuarterPicker: (<ValueType_1 = DateType>(props: import("./interface").PickerPropsWithMultiple<DateType, Omit<import("./interface").PickerProps<DateType>, "picker">, ValueType_1>) => import("react").ReactElement<any, string | import("react").JSXElementConstructor<any>>) & {
|
34 | displayName?: string | undefined;
|
35 | };
|
36 | };
|
37 | export default generatePicker;
|
38 |
|
\ | No newline at end of file |